漂洗漂洗  放射学术语。定影后的胶片通过清水冲洗,去除残存的硫代硫酸钠和少量银的络合物的过程,又称水洗。漂洗是保证胶片质量和长期保存的重要步骤。在定影后的胶片乳剂层表面或/和内部,残存的硫代硫酸钠如不冲洗掉,会与空气中CO2和水作用,分解出硫,硫与银作用形成棕黄色的硫化银,使影像变黄。并且,未经水洗或水洗不彻底的胶片在长期贮存过程中,还会产生有毒的硫化氢气体,进一步使影像褪色,胶片变黄。
